Situated near the coast, approximately one hour east of RAF Lakenheath and 90 minutes from RAF Alconbury and Molesworth, this fantastic city is a great starting point.
As the county seat of Norfolk, the history of Norwich is on full display. Famously known as one of the most complete medieval cities in the U.K., much of the architecture dates back to the 11th century. The Norwich Cathedral has seen more than 1,000 years of turmoil, war and pandemics. Dramatic arches, towering spires and ornate vaulted ceilings contribute to this beautiful house of worship. Pass through the St. Ethelbert or Erpingham Gates, the two surviving gates to the cathedral dating back to the Middle Ages.
Near the cathedral, visitors can step back in time as they walk along the cobblestone streets of Elm Hill. Colorful half-timbered houses precariously line the narrow sidewalks much as they have done since the Middle Ages.
The stout square fortress of the Norwich Castle houses an eclectic array of historical dioramas and a gallery of wildlife exhibits. One of the many fortifications ordered by William the Conqueror after his invasion of 1066, it is a great example of a Norman castle.
Grab a takeaway picnic from a local pub (there are plenty to choose from) and drink in the sights along the River Wensum. A multi-use trail runs alongside the waterway through town.
Marvel movie fans will want to stop by the Sainsbury Centre at the University of East Anglia, which doubled as the Avengers’ headquarters. It is actually an art museum.
